簡(jiǎn)單回顧下知識(shí):
<code>push()</code>:項(xiàng)數(shù)組末尾添加一個(gè)或多個(gè)元素
<code>unshift()</code>:項(xiàng)數(shù)組的開(kāi)頭添加一個(gè)或多個(gè)元素
<code>pop()</code>:刪除數(shù)組的最后一個(gè)元素
<code>shift()</code>:刪除數(shù)組的第一個(gè)元素
<code>sort()</code>:給數(shù)組排序
<code>reverse()</code>:顛倒數(shù)組在數(shù)組中的位置
<code>concat()</code>:將數(shù)組添加到數(shù)組末端、數(shù)組合并
<code>slice()</code>:指定位置,刪除指定的數(shù)組項(xiàng),返回刪除的數(shù)組項(xiàng)為一個(gè)新數(shù)組
<code>splice()</code>:對(duì)數(shù)組進(jìn)行刪除,插入和替換
<code>indexOf()</code>:從前向后查找元素在數(shù)組中的位置
<code>lastIndexOf()</code>:從后項(xiàng)前查找元素在數(shù)組中的位置
<code>foreEach()</code><code>every()</code><code>some()</code><code>filter()</code><code>map()</code>:數(shù)組迭代
<code>reduce()</code>:數(shù)組中的每個(gè)值從左志友開(kāi)始合并,最終為一個(gè)值
<code>reduceRight()</code>:數(shù)組中的每個(gè)值從右至左合并,最終為一個(gè)值
數(shù)組求和
var array=[],num=null;//假定一個(gè)從1到100的數(shù)組
for(var i=0;i<100;i++){
array[i]=i+1;
}
function getsum(array){//求和函數(shù)
var num=0;
for(var i=0;i<array.length;i++){
num=num+array[i];
}
}
for/while循環(huán)求和
//for 循環(huán)求和
console.time("getSum");
for(var i=0;i<100000;i++){//100000
getsum(array);
}
console.timeEnd("getSum");//打印執(zhí)行時(shí)間
console.log(num);
while
(function(){
num = 0;
function getSum(array){
var i = array.length;
while(i--){
num+=parseInt(array[i]);
}
return num;
}
console.time("getSum");
for(var i=0;i<100000;i++){//100000
getsum(array);
}
console.timeEnd("getSum");//打印執(zhí)行時(shí)間
console.log(num);
})()
for in
(function(){
function getsum(array){//求和函數(shù)
num=0;
for(var i in array){
num=num+array[i];
}
}
console.time("for-in-getSum");
for(var i=0;i<100000;i++){//100000
num = 0;
getsum(array);
}
console.timeEnd("for-in-getSum");//for-in-getSum: 846.880ms
})();
出了常用的for/while,我們利用新學(xué)習(xí)的數(shù)組迭代方法進(jìn)行求和運(yùn)算
forEach
//forEach
(function(){
function getSum(current,index,array){//foreach的函數(shù)參數(shù)代表什么意思?
num=num+current;
}
console.time("forEach-getSum");
for(var i=0;i<100000;i++){//100000
num = 0;
array.forEach(getSum)
}
console.timeEnd("forEach-getSum");//forEach-getSum: 119.355ms
console.log(num);
})();
every
(function(){
function getSum(current,index,array){//數(shù)組每一個(gè)元素都通過(guò)返回1或者0 所以需要返回true
num=num+current;
return true
}
console.time("every-getSum");
for(var i=0;i<100000;i++){//100000
num = 0;
array.every(getSum)
}
console.timeEnd("every-getSum");//every-getSum: 124.082ms
console.log(num);//5050
})();
map
(function(){
function getSum(current,index,array){
num=num+current;
}
console.time("map-getSum");
for(var i=0;i<100000;i++){//100000
num = 0;
array.map(getSum);//map每次調(diào)用的結(jié)果返回新數(shù)組
}
console.timeEnd("map-getSum");//map-getSum: 1116.257ms
console.log(num);//5050
})();
some
(function(){
function getSum(current,index,array){//用some怎么遍歷求和呢?
num=num+current;
}
console.time("some-getSum");
for(var i=0;i<100000;i++){//100000
num = 0;
array.some(getSum)
}
console.timeEnd("some-getSum");//some-getSum: 128.142ms
console.log(num);//5050
})();
filter
(function(){
function getSum(current,index,array){
num=num+current;
}
console.time("filter-getSum");
for(var i=0;i<100000;i++){//100000
num = 0;
array.filter(getSum);//filter將滿足條件的元素形成新的數(shù)組
}
console.timeEnd("filter-getSum");//filter-getSum: 136.716ms
console.log(num);//5050
})();
reduce
//reduce
(function(){
function getSum(preValue,curValue,index, array) {
return preValue + curValue;
}
console.time("reduce-getSum");
for (var i = 0; i < 100000; i++){
sum = array.reduce(getSum, 0)
}
console.timeEnd("reduce-getSum"); // 70.942ms
})()
最后發(fā)現(xiàn)while的執(zhí)行之間最短,reduce 也比較快。雖然這些遍歷的方法能讓實(shí)現(xiàn)數(shù)組的求和,但是不同的方法對(duì)性能有所不同。盡管很簡(jiǎn)單,但也是自身的學(xué)習(xí)。如果您發(fā)現(xiàn)有什么錯(cuò)誤,歡迎反饋給我。
